Output 8d63ffc96ef51b78a6eaa2f8af51fe08c7e6a73d34246502ec8c4ad651cb7e7b:38

value
31572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b62a88bae2c504d792a47d38a61dd85ce7275d OP_EQUAL
address
3EX2kXTUW9x7ySJKDbPTQDLXntqrhZTu9v
transaction
8d63ffc96ef51b78a6eaa2f8af51fe08c7e6a73d34246502ec8c4ad651cb7e7b
spent
true